It is not often that the internet surprises me these days, it being in some kind of state of maturity by now. However, I was bowled over by a corner of the int0rweb I found yesterday. A mate pointed me in the direction of KCRW's website, a community service radio station in California. More specifically I was urged to check out their Morning Becomes Eclectic show. This show invites various great (according to me) bands to come in and play live in the studio for around 40 minutes each day and have a bit of general chat also. The truly awesome part is that they webcast these sessions live each day (audio and video) and they have a huge archive of the shows. To name just a few of the sessions you can watch here are installments featuring The Arcade Fire, Bloc Party, The White Stripes, The New Pornographers, Röyksopp, Sufjan Stevens, Stephen Malkamus, Interpol, our own Bell X1, Doves, Beck, Mercury Rev, Wilco, Sonic Youth, The Caridgans, Snow Patrol, Air... I could keep going. They obviously haven't heard of the Gerry Ryan format for 9am-midday on the radio over there yet.
With all respect to the list of artists above, I suggest you drop what you're doing right now and dig out the most recent Stars session on Morning Becomes Eclectic. It is particularily excellent and is exactly what I needed after their storming gig last weekend left me wanting more. They all even appear sober in the studio ;)
